You 100% need to get some hand warmers in your pockets (toe warmers also work). They sell them in 10 packs at Walmart for a few bucks if you don’t want to buy them at a ski shop, they have them on amazon too. Put some in your pocket where you keep your camera gear/iPhone before you put on your skis and get on hill. It’ll keep your equipment nice and toasty so when you go to actually film it won’t die on you within 5 seconds & you can record a good bit of footage throughout the day since the hand warmers have a few hours of heat in them.

smh at people who just upgrade solely because their batteries wear out. A battery replacement strait from apple has been $29 for all of 2018, and is going back up to $49 instead of the standard $79 after the new year. $49 is nothing to get the performance of a new phone again, without actually paying for a new phone
